Description

This non-compete and non-solicitation agreement has been entered into by a corporation and an employee. The employee agrees not to become employed by, or enter into any similar agreement as a director, employee, independent contractor, consultant, agent or partner with another corporation similar to the one identified within the agreement during the closing of a twenty-four month recapitalization venture.

The Indiana Supreme Court in Heraeus also noted the statement that non-solicitation of employee restrictions must be limited only to those employees in which the employer has a legitimate protectable interest. Generally, Indiana courts don't look favorably on non-compete contracts. The employer has the burden of proof, meaning they must show the court that the agreement is enforceable. The court may find a contract to be completely void or may hold both parties to a modified version.

California courts have already determined that non-disclosure and client/customer non-solicitation agreements are not valid or enforceable.

For the same reasons that it prohibits non-competes, California law generally prohibits enforcement of non-solicitation agreements against former employees, because those agreements tend to restrain individuals from engaging in their professions or occupations. Since non-solicitation agreements are generally more specific than non-compete agreements, they are more readily enforced by courts. To be enforceable, non-solicitation agreements must abide by certain rules: Valid business reason.

The non-solicitation agreement is a less restrictive contract and is narrowly aimed at preventing an employee from soliciting his or her former employer's clients. Unlike the non-compete agreement, the employee is allowed to immediately start work in the same industry and in the same geographic area.
